Listing remarks MLS
Welcome to this well-maintained penthouse 1-bedroom co-op in the prestigious Riviera Towers, offering unmatched panoramic-north views of New Jersey and up to the George Washington Bridge. Set up high on the 34th floor, this spacious unit features large windows that flood the living space with natural light. Riviera Towers is a full-service building with 24-hour doorman, fitness center, outdoor swimming pool & much more. Commuting is effortless with easy access to NYC via NJ Transit bus. Maintenance TOTAL including taxes, basic utilities & reserves is ($1,598.40) + a capital repair assessment that runs until Oct. 2026 ($746.40) is $2,344.80. Cable & Internet is available at an additional $38.00 per month. An all cash purchase requires a minimum income of $85,000/year. Subject to board approval: Min 10% down, 3-to-1 Income-to-Debt Ratio.

For passive investors: Depreciation is non-cash, so a rental often shows a tax loss while cash-flowing — sheltering income. Rental losses are passive: they offset passive income freely, and up to $25,000/yr can offset ordinary (W-2) income if you actively participate and your MAGI is under $100k (phasing out to $0 by $150k); unused losses carry forward. On sale, claimed depreciation is recaptured at up to 25%, and gains may owe capital-gains tax (a 1031 exchange can defer both). Figures are a year-1 estimate at your 24.0% rate — not tax advice; consult a CPA.
